## FX Hedging Update — Managers Only

Quick heads-up for sales leads: after the krona wobble last quarter, Marlowe in treasury convinced us to lock in forward contracts covering roughly 70% of expected Veltrane export receipts through Q3. That means pricing for the Oskarsby and Trellhaven accounts stays stable — no mid-contract adjustments, please don't promise otherwise. The remaining 30% floats deliberately so we can capture upside if rates swing our way. Questions go to Marlowe's team. The next section covers where this leads strategically.

board note of fafog-yahap: Project Rusdor slips by a full year because of the audit delay.

**Q: How do I retry a failed export in Lanternfold?**

Failed exports stay in the queue for 72 hours. Open the Export Console, select the failed job, and choose Retry with Original Parameters. If the job fails twice, escalate to the Quillbrook platform team rather than retrying again, since repeated failures usually indicate a schema drift issue. To unlock the escalation vault for attaching job artifacts, use the recovery passphrase below.

unlock words, hahip-baduf: holwyn-istath-julvan

## Tuning

DeployBeak polls the release tracker and posts status to channels. Plugin authors should respect the built-in rate limits; exceeding them causes the bot to drop your plugin's messages silently. Polling cadence, message batching, and retry backoff are all configurable but bounded by the host. The enforced defaults your plugin inherits are as follows.

constants for tageg-kagag:
QUOTAS = {
    "kelax": 495,
    "istath": 366,
    "tammir": 108,
    "novdor": 730,
    "casax": 816,
    "quenael": 874,
    "pelius": 403,
}